MEMO — Tessler & Vane, Internal Only

To: Branch Managers
Re: Hiring Freeze, Fieldworks Division

Effective immediately, all recruitment within the Fieldworks Division is paused, including backfills and contractor extensions. Offers already signed will be honoured. Internal transfers require divisional sign-off. This measure follows the mid-year review and is expected to last one quarter, subject to reassessment. Please route any exception requests through your regional lead. The underlying business rationale is set out in the note below.

confidential, yahof-hahig: The finance team signed off on a budget of $169.6 million for Project Julox.

The Brambleway gateway enforces rate limits on all internal service routes. Default quotas are 500 requests per minute per service token, with burst allowances configured per team in the Lanternfall registry. If your integration hits a 429, back off exponentially and check your quota tier before retrying. Quota increases require a short justification and usually clear within one business day. Do not share tokens between services to work around limits. For quota requests or unexplained throttling, reach the gateway team at the address below.

alerts address for kajog-tadup: druox@plorvanet.internal

Subject: Soft deletes in the orders table

Hi, welcome aboard. Quick heads-up before your first shift: the Marrow orders table uses soft deletes. Rows are never removed; instead `deleted_at` is set and the nightly Broomhilde job archives anything older than 90 days. Most "missing order" tickets are just filtered queries — always check `deleted_at` before escalating. Restores are self-service via the admin console. The full procedure, including edge cases around refunds, is documented on the internal page here.

operations page: https://jira.qorvelsys.internal/browse/pages/browse/pages